Homalocladium ‘Ribbons and Curls’ (Tapeworm Plant)

Plant Description:
Homalocladium ‘Ribbons and Curls’, also known as Tapeworm Plant or Ribbon Bush, is a unique evergreen shrub characterized by its flattened, leaf-like green stems that twist and curl in a ribbon-like fashion. These segmented stems give the plant a sculptural appearance, often resembling green tapeworms or ribbons cascading from the plant’s base. Tiny white flowers appear along the stems, followed by small red berries that add seasonal interest.

Grow Zone:
Best suited for USDA Zones 9–11. In Zone 9, Tapeworm plant may die back to the ground during light frost but typically regrows in spring. This plant performs best with protection from freezing temperatures.

Height and Width:
Mature plants reach about 4–6 feet tall and 3–5 feet wide in the landscape, though in containers they may remain smaller.

Sun and Water Requirements:
Homalocladium thrives in full sun to partial shade. It prefers consistently moist, well-drained soil but tolerates short dry periods once established. Avoid waterlogging, as this can lead to root rot. Regular watering during hot, dry weather encourages lush growth.

Uses:
Tapeworm plant’s unusual form makes it ideal as a conversation piece in tropical gardens, modern landscapes, or as a container specimen. It can be grown indoors in bright light as a houseplant or outdoors in mixed borders, courtyard gardens, and decorative pots. The striking stem structure also complements minimalist or architectural plantings.

Native Range:
Native to the Solomon Islands in the South Pacific, where it grows in warm, humid, coastal environments.

Zone 9 Tips:
In Louisiana and similar Zone 9 climates, plant Homalocladium in a location sheltered from cold winter winds and frost, such as near a wall or under a patio cover. Mulch around the base in late fall to protect roots from cold snaps, and reduce watering during cool months when growth slows. In colder periods, it can be overwintered indoors near a bright window.
